Timeline
13 December 2021
Written question
To ask the Secretary of State for Education, what estimate he made of the proportion of his Department's overall spending on apprenticeships that supports people aged 18 to 25.
Source: Commons
16 December 2021
Answer
Apprenticeships are available for anyone aged 16 or over, and in the 2020/21 academic year young people under the age of 25 accounted for 50% of apprenticeship starts.In the 2020-21 financial year total apprenticeships participation spend for apprentices ...
